A Colorado state senator has introduced a bill that would allow electric vehicle (EV) manufacturers to sell their vehicles directly to customers, bypassing dealership.
According to the Colorado Sun, Sen. Chris Hansen's Senate Bill 167 would amend a law that currently prohibits all manufacturers, except for Tesla, from selling directly to consumers. The bill so far has the baking of some government officials and electric car maker Rivian.
